WebOct 25, 2024 · To check your Git version, open Command Prompt (Windows) , Terminal (Mac), or the Linux terminal. Once open, run this command: git --version. The Git version you’re currently using will be returned. Now that you know which version of Git you’re using, you can decide if you want to update it or not. WebMar 17, 2024 · Git is a version control system that developers use all over the world. It helps you track different versions of your code and collaborate with other developers. If you are working on a project over time, you may want to keep track of which changes were made, by whom, and when those changes were made. WebOct 15, 2014 · If you want to get the specific version. You can get it via commit id. You can get the commit id in logs. So first try git log to get specific commit id Then try git reset --hard commit_id But this will not allow you to commit the version. This is read only of a specific version. WebA version control system, or VCS, tracks the history of changes as people and teams collaborate on projects together. As developers make changes to the project, any earlier version of the project can be recovered at any time. Developers can review project history to find out: Which changes were made?
